10. Why is my AirTrack losing air? If your AirTrack is losing air, it may be due to small punctures, leaks, or improper sealing of the valve. Inspect the surface of the mat carefully for any signs of damage, and check the valve for proper closure and sealing. Patch any holes promptly using a repair kit to prevent further air loss and maintain optimal inflation.

11. How long does an AirTrack stay inflated? The inflation duration of an AirTrack mat varies depending on factors such as its size, quality, and environmental conditions. Generally, a properly inflated AirTrack should maintain its pressure for several days to weeks, depending on usage frequency and storage conditions. It's essential to monitor the inflation level regularly and top up the air as needed to ensure optimal performance.

18. How to clean an AirTrack? To clean your AirTrack mat, start by wiping down the surface with a damp cloth and mild soap to remove dirt, sweat, and debris. Avoid using har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ners, as they can damage the surface of the mat and affect its performance. For stubborn stains or dirt buildup, use a soft-bristled brush or sponge to gently scrub the affected areas, then rinse the mat thoroughly with clean water and allow it to air dry completely before storage or future use.

22. How much is a gymnastics air track? The cost of a gymnastics air track varies depending on factors such as size, brand, quality, and features. Entry-level mats start at around $100, while premium models can range from $300 to $1000 or more, offering superior durability, performance, and versatility. Tumbl Trak provides ten feet, sixteen toes and twenty feet duration choices all with 8″ thickness and an incredibly generous width of over six feet. The velcro placements on all four sides allow for buyers the choice to attach various models with each other to create a good for a longer period track or maybe a sq. flooring, and that is extra much like a gymnastics ground. Less costly options don’t offer velcro on The 2 finishes let alone all 4 sides.
